基于民航气象数据库的异构数据库格式转化方案与实现
合集下载
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
1 方案实现的原理及数据流 程图
显然 , 为了达到异构平台和数据库转换 的 目的 , 编写一 个小 的软件同样 可以实现 , 如果利用数 据库本身 的功能 但 实现 , 则解决方案更 具稳定性 和科学性.
最初的气象服务系统是 6 1系统配置的客户端 软件 直 2
21 在 S LSr r . Q v 中建立链 接服务器 , 向 s a 库. ee 指 ys be 方法 1企业管理 器一安 全性一 连 接服务器一 右键 新 : 建连接服务器一定义连接 名称一选其 他数据 源. 指定程 序
G0
方法 2: sl 询分 析器 中执行 以下 代码 建立 链接 : 在 q查
E e p x cs
—
adikdevr ̄yae dl esre S bs n
" D S L U L MS A Q N L ,
}{ ;
2 3 建立 作业并设置调 度频率 , . 确定异 步更新 S L Sre Q evr 库的时间间隔
第3 0卷 第 6期
201 0年 6月
咸
宁
学
院
学
报
Vo . 0, . 1 3 No 6
J u n lo a nn iv ri t
Jn 2 1 u .0 0
文章编 号 :0 6— 32 2 1 )6— 06— 3 10 54 (0 0 0 04 0
关键词 : 民航 ; 气象; 数据库 ; 格式转化
中 图分 类 号 :P 1 .3 T 3 11 1 文 献 标 识码 : A
民航气象卫 星传真广播系统 ( 民航气象数 据库系统 ) , 俗称 6 1 2 系统 , 主要分 通信前置机 和 sbs 数 据库 两个分 y ae 系统 , 均在 U I N X平台下 , 主要任务是实时接收 和传递 民航 气象情报和资料 , 并将气 象情 报和资料存 储到 sbs yae数据 库. 虽然 6 1系统安装之初 配置 了报 文和 图形 图像 检索打 2 印软件 , 但随着 民航气象业务的发展 , 航空公司和相关行业
是最好 的选 择 , 为了提高航空气象服务 的质量和效率 , 开发 bs / 结构 的基于 We b的气象服 务平 台的需求与 日俱增 , 然 而, 对于航站一级的气象 台数据库维护科 室 ,nx和 sbs ui y ae
l报 f 公库 l I
储 储 ● 过 ●● ● 过 ● ●
民 航气j61 | 2系统 I
通 信莆置机
,
MS Q re 应用库 L e r S S v
作业 存 存 ● ● ●
S ae 始库  ̄ s原
对航空气象服务也不 断提 出新 的需求 和更高 的要求. 作为 航空气 象服务 的核心 ,2s a 数据库 受硬件 、 件和开 6 1 bs y e 软 发人员水平的限制已逐渐显露 , 步成为气 象二次 产品 和 逐 气象服务的瓶颈 . 随着新 的 We b技术的不断发展 , 传统 的 cs / 模式 已不
名称 为: Y A E A A TV E V R A Y E E P O S B S D P IE SR E N WH R R .
接访问 Sbs 原 始库 , ya e 功能单一 , 操作不够简便 . 图所示 如 ( 图中箭头所示为系统数据流程) 将 Sbs , yae原始库链接 到 MSS LS r r Q v 本地应用库后 , e e 利用作业将原始库 中 的常用
・ 收 稿 日期 :0 00 -2 2 1 -30
第 6期
郑 标
基于民航气象数据库的并构数据库格式转化方案与实现
4 7
全性标签页里 , 设置用此安 全上下 文进行 , 录入 S B S 并 Y AE 的数据库用户名 和密码一 服 务器 选 项标 签 页可 默认 一确
定. ee ( S xc @ )
基于 民航气象数据库的 异构数据库格式转化方案与实现
郑 标
( 民航青 岛空中交通管理站气象台, 山东 青岛 2 60 ) 6 18
摘
要: 文章主要介绍对民航 气象数据库 系统的数据库进行 扩展
- @A 案 , - 通过转化 , 将该数据 库 中的 实时数
据从 ui 平 台下的 sbs nx yae数据库复制到 wn o s 台下的 MSS Lsre 数据库 中, 高了原始数据库 的安全性 , idw 平 Q vr e 提 同时永久保存 了历史数据 , 有利 于二次开发 和应用.
I 库I l告 l 报
程 程 …
I
,
,
公库I报库 报 l告
● ■ l t
都不是 w幽 开发的最佳选 择. 了 证气象原始数 据库 的 为 保
安全 , 方便快捷地进 行气 象二次 开发 , 本文 拟将 u x平 台 i n 下 sbs yae数据库 的资料异步转存 到常见 的 Widw 平台下 nos
的报告定时异步导入应用库 , 即可方便 的供 We b服务器调 用和后续开发.
VD R . , IE 8 0 产品名 称可 不填 , 数据 源指定 O B D C中定义好
的数据源名称 61提供程序 字符 串按 以下格式 填写 :s 2, Ue r I d be ,asod= {}女 }}. 里的用户 名和 密 D= dgn Psw r 这 码对应所要连接的 S B S Y A E数据库 中的用户名和密码 一 安
的 M Q e e 本地应用库 中 , SS LSr r v 这样在气象服务 的客户端
We b服务器
I
■
二次 开发
I
l
2 技 术 实现
客户端
就 不用再直接访 问原始数据库’ , 将原始库 和 We b服务 网隔 离 开, 大大降低 了 sbs yae库的负载 , 降低了开发的难度 , 也 同时解决 了原始库资料 只保存 三天 的历史 问题. 既保证 了 原始库 的安全 , 也提高 了 w b访问的速度. e
显然 , 为了达到异构平台和数据库转换 的 目的 , 编写一 个小 的软件同样 可以实现 , 如果利用数 据库本身 的功能 但 实现 , 则解决方案更 具稳定性 和科学性.
最初的气象服务系统是 6 1系统配置的客户端 软件 直 2
21 在 S LSr r . Q v 中建立链 接服务器 , 向 s a 库. ee 指 ys be 方法 1企业管理 器一安 全性一 连 接服务器一 右键 新 : 建连接服务器一定义连接 名称一选其 他数据 源. 指定程 序
G0
方法 2: sl 询分 析器 中执行 以下 代码 建立 链接 : 在 q查
E e p x cs
—
adikdevr ̄yae dl esre S bs n
" D S L U L MS A Q N L ,
}{ ;
2 3 建立 作业并设置调 度频率 , . 确定异 步更新 S L Sre Q evr 库的时间间隔
第3 0卷 第 6期
201 0年 6月
咸
宁
学
院
学
报
Vo . 0, . 1 3 No 6
J u n lo a nn iv ri t
Jn 2 1 u .0 0
文章编 号 :0 6— 32 2 1 )6— 06— 3 10 54 (0 0 0 04 0
关键词 : 民航 ; 气象; 数据库 ; 格式转化
中 图分 类 号 :P 1 .3 T 3 11 1 文 献 标 识码 : A
民航气象卫 星传真广播系统 ( 民航气象数 据库系统 ) , 俗称 6 1 2 系统 , 主要分 通信前置机 和 sbs 数 据库 两个分 y ae 系统 , 均在 U I N X平台下 , 主要任务是实时接收 和传递 民航 气象情报和资料 , 并将气 象情 报和资料存 储到 sbs yae数据 库. 虽然 6 1系统安装之初 配置 了报 文和 图形 图像 检索打 2 印软件 , 但随着 民航气象业务的发展 , 航空公司和相关行业
是最好 的选 择 , 为了提高航空气象服务 的质量和效率 , 开发 bs / 结构 的基于 We b的气象服 务平 台的需求与 日俱增 , 然 而, 对于航站一级的气象 台数据库维护科 室 ,nx和 sbs ui y ae
l报 f 公库 l I
储 储 ● 过 ●● ● 过 ● ●
民 航气j61 | 2系统 I
通 信莆置机
,
MS Q re 应用库 L e r S S v
作业 存 存 ● ● ●
S ae 始库  ̄ s原
对航空气象服务也不 断提 出新 的需求 和更高 的要求. 作为 航空气 象服务 的核心 ,2s a 数据库 受硬件 、 件和开 6 1 bs y e 软 发人员水平的限制已逐渐显露 , 步成为气 象二次 产品 和 逐 气象服务的瓶颈 . 随着新 的 We b技术的不断发展 , 传统 的 cs / 模式 已不
名称 为: Y A E A A TV E V R A Y E E P O S B S D P IE SR E N WH R R .
接访问 Sbs 原 始库 , ya e 功能单一 , 操作不够简便 . 图所示 如 ( 图中箭头所示为系统数据流程) 将 Sbs , yae原始库链接 到 MSS LS r r Q v 本地应用库后 , e e 利用作业将原始库 中 的常用
・ 收 稿 日期 :0 00 -2 2 1 -30
第 6期
郑 标
基于民航气象数据库的并构数据库格式转化方案与实现
4 7
全性标签页里 , 设置用此安 全上下 文进行 , 录入 S B S 并 Y AE 的数据库用户名 和密码一 服 务器 选 项标 签 页可 默认 一确
定. ee ( S xc @ )
基于 民航气象数据库的 异构数据库格式转化方案与实现
郑 标
( 民航青 岛空中交通管理站气象台, 山东 青岛 2 60 ) 6 18
摘
要: 文章主要介绍对民航 气象数据库 系统的数据库进行 扩展
- @A 案 , - 通过转化 , 将该数据 库 中的 实时数
据从 ui 平 台下的 sbs nx yae数据库复制到 wn o s 台下的 MSS Lsre 数据库 中, 高了原始数据库 的安全性 , idw 平 Q vr e 提 同时永久保存 了历史数据 , 有利 于二次开发 和应用.
I 库I l告 l 报
程 程 …
I
,
,
公库I报库 报 l告
● ■ l t
都不是 w幽 开发的最佳选 择. 了 证气象原始数 据库 的 为 保
安全 , 方便快捷地进 行气 象二次 开发 , 本文 拟将 u x平 台 i n 下 sbs yae数据库 的资料异步转存 到常见 的 Widw 平台下 nos
的报告定时异步导入应用库 , 即可方便 的供 We b服务器调 用和后续开发.
VD R . , IE 8 0 产品名 称可 不填 , 数据 源指定 O B D C中定义好
的数据源名称 61提供程序 字符 串按 以下格式 填写 :s 2, Ue r I d be ,asod= {}女 }}. 里的用户 名和 密 D= dgn Psw r 这 码对应所要连接的 S B S Y A E数据库 中的用户名和密码 一 安
的 M Q e e 本地应用库 中 , SS LSr r v 这样在气象服务 的客户端
We b服务器
I
■
二次 开发
I
l
2 技 术 实现
客户端
就 不用再直接访 问原始数据库’ , 将原始库 和 We b服务 网隔 离 开, 大大降低 了 sbs yae库的负载 , 降低了开发的难度 , 也 同时解决 了原始库资料 只保存 三天 的历史 问题. 既保证 了 原始库 的安全 , 也提高 了 w b访问的速度. e